Cleofe, ex-PBA legal counsel, 58

Lawyer Ruben “Butch” Cleofe, who served under three commissioners as legal counsel of the Philippine Basketball Association, passed away Saturday morning after a massive heart attack at his residence.

He would have turned 59 on Nov. 26.

Cleofe, who came into the PBA in the early 1980s as a protégé of then legal counsel Rodrigo Salud, first was also the secretary of the board for more than a decade before retiring in 2001.

Cleofe, who graduated from the Ateneo Law School and finished in the Top 10 of the 1977 bar examinations, held the legal counsel position of PBCom at the time of his death.

He recently returned to the PBA as a legal adviser on the prodding of good friend and fellow Atenean and PBA commissioner Sonny Barrios.

Cleofe’s remains lie in state at the Loyola Memorial Chapels in Marikina. Interment will be announced later.
